Understanding HTML: A Beginner's Guide

HTML, or HyperText Markup Language, is the cornerstone of web development. It structures the content on the web, allowing developers to create websites that are functional, accessible, and visually appealing.

What is HTML?

HTML is a markup language that defines the structure of your web pages. It consists of a series of elements or tags that denote how content should be displayed on the Internet.

The Structure of an HTML Document

Every HTML document follows a specific structure. Here are the essential components:

  1. Doctype Declaration: This tells the web browser which version of HTML the page is written in.
  2. Tag: The beginning of the HTML document.
  3. Section: Contains meta-information about the document, like the title and links to stylesheets.
  4. Section: This is where the content of the page is placed, including text, images, and links.

Common HTML Tags

Here are a few basic HTML tags that every beginner should know:

  • <h1> to <h6>: Heading tags that define headings of different levels.
  • <p>: The paragraph tag, used for text blocks.
  • <a>: The anchor tag, used to create hyperlinks.
  • <img>: The image tag, which embeds images into the page.
  • <div>: A container used to group elements for CSS styling and layout purposes.

Best Practices for Writing HTML

To ensure your HTML documents are clean and efficient, consider these best practices:

  • Keep your code organized and properly indented.
  • Use semantic tags to improve accessibility and SEO.
  • Comment on your code to clarify your intent for future reference.
  • Validate your HTML through online tools to ensure there are no errors.
